CBD - now also allowed for athletes!

In January 2018, the World Anti-Doping Agency (WADA) removed cannabidiol (CBD) from the list of substances prohibited for athletes after thorough consultation with experts. The evidence so far shows that CBD could also benefit athletes without affecting their results. CBD is a natural extract from the flowers of Cannabis sativa L. with a low THC content, which is neither psychoactive nor toxic. Due to its many therapeutic potentials, it is used as an aid for inflammation, pain, anxiety, depression, dementia, epilepsy, diabetes, cancer and other diseases...

CBD and the elderly

CBD – a cannabinoid from industrial hemp flowers – is one of the safest molecules. It does not have the psychoactive effects typical of THC, and studies using both low and high (1500 mg) daily doses of CBD have not documented overdose. It has anti-inflammatory, analgesic, anxiolytic, antidepressant, neuroprotective, antidiabetic and many other effects, as it supports the function of the endocannabinoid system (ECS) (1) (a collection of numerous studies on the topic of CBD and problems). Alzheimer's and risk factors

Medicine is still searching for the causes and treatments for Alzheimer's disease. In general, researchers believe that Alzheimer's is partly the result of genetics, environmental influences and an individual's lifestyle. Risk factors for the development of the problem include, among others, lack of physical activity, obesity, high blood pressure, diabetes, depression and smoking. An overview of the possibilities of using cannabis and cannabinoids in medicine

Cannabinoids act primarily on two organ systems: the nervous system and the immune system. As a result, deviations in the functioning of the endocannabinoid system are associated with the pathology of these two systems, that is, with neurological-psychiatric disorders and disorders of the immune system and inflammatory response, as well as the widest therapeutic potential of cannabinoids in the treatment of pathologies related to these systems.
